Adirondack hit Westmoreland with a five-run second inning on Tuesday, which goes a long way in explaining the final result. The Bulldogs lost 8-0 to the Wildcats. The Bulldogs have struggled against the Wildcats recently, as the game was their third consecutive lost meeting.
Westmoreland's defeat dropped their record down to 0-2. As for Adirondack, with the victory, they broke their three-game losing streak and moved their record to 4-3.
